Water Damage Prevention in Sunnyside, OR: Protecting Your Home from Flooding

In Sunnyside, OR, the area experiences an average of 16 inches of rainfall annually, with most of it falling between December and March. This heavy rainfall can cause water to seep into your home, leading to costly damages and health hazards. Your home’s foundation, walls, and floors are at risk of water damage if you don’t take preventive measures. Check for cracks in your foundation, walls, and floors. Ensure your gutters and downspouts are clear and functioning properly. Consider installing a sump pump and backup system.
